WebJan 13, 2024 · While SAAMI says the .22 LR cartridge overall length (COL) is exactly 1.000 inch, the SAAMI chamber and throat is only 0.8751 inch, so the bullet extends 0.1249 inch into the bore upon chambering. While bullet diameter is 0.2255 inch, bore diameter is 0.217 inch and a high-BC bullet design would have to take this into account as well. signs of backwardness of a country https://jcjacksonconsulting.com

WebNov 29, 2024 · In the coming years, 5.56 ammunition would face literal trial by fire in Vietnam and further development based on those experiences. Flash forward again to 1980, when, after three years of testing, NATO's International Test Control Commission agreed to name 5.56 the standard cartridge for infantry military service around the world.
